The National Monuments Service's description

Situated at the crest of the S-facing slope of a low hill. This is an oval area (dims. c. 40m E W; c. 30m N S) defined by an earthen bank (at N: Wth c. 4m; int. H 0.5m; ext. H 1.4m) with an external fosse (at N: Wth of base 2m; D 0.2 0.7m). Outside the fosse is a berm (at N: Wth 5m), a fosse (at N: Wth of top 4.7m; Wth of base 2m; int. D 0.7m) and an outer bank (Wth 4m; int. H 1.4m; ext. H 0.5m), all of which may be modern (SMR file). It was removed since 1987, but is visible as an enclosure defined by three fosse features on aerial photographs (MM (55) 30-6).

The above description is derived from the published 'Archaeological Inventory of County Wexford' (Dublin: Stationery Office, 1996). In certain instances the entries have been revised and updated in the light of recent research.
